Tetyana Chumak is a scholar working on Sensory Systems, Neurology and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health. According to data from OpenAlex, Tetyana Chumak has authored 25 papers receiving a total of 473 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Sensory Systems, 7 papers in Neurology and 6 papers in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health. Recurrent topics in Tetyana Chumak’s work include Hearing, Cochlea, Tinnitus, Genetics (11 papers), Neuroinflammation and Neurodegeneration Mechanisms (5 papers) and Neonatal and fetal brain pathology (4 papers). Tetyana Chumak is often cited by papers focused on Hearing, Cochlea, Tinnitus, Genetics (11 papers), Neuroinflammation and Neurodegeneration Mechanisms (5 papers) and Neonatal and fetal brain pathology (4 papers). Tetyana Chumak collaborates with scholars based in Sweden, Czechia and United States. Tetyana Chumak's co-authors include Carina Mallard, Josef Syka, Maryam Ardalan, Jiří Popelář, C. Joakim Ek, Ilse Riebe, Zinaida S. Vexler, Amin Mottahedin, Gabriela Pavlínková and Bernd Fritzsch and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Neuroscience, Brain Research and Scientific Reports.
